Biography

Kseniia Power is a lecturer at the Penn Language Center, specializing in Ukrainian language instruction. Originally from Kyiv, Ukraine, she completed her K-12 education before pursuing higher education. Kseniia obtained her Bachelor’s degree in Communications from the University of Akron, where she also played Division tennis. She furthered her studies with a Master's degree in Physical Education, Sport Science, and Coaching at the same institution. For her master’s thesis, she analyzed the effects of coaching behaviors and intrinsic motivation on the scholarship status of NCAA Division tennis players and their sport commitment. Kseniia completed her PhD in Kinesiology at Temple University, focusing on psychology and human movement. Her dissertation examined eating disorders and body image issues in collegiate athletes, reflecting her commitment to advancing knowledge in the field of sports psychology. She has also served as a Volunteer Assistant Women’s Tennis Coach at Temple University, enriching her practical experience in sports education.
